Beyond the Bath: Why a Dog Spa is the Secret to a Happy, Healthy Yatesville Pup

Living in Yatesville, Georgia, means our dogs enjoy the best of Southern life—long walks down quiet country roads, playful romps in the backyard, and the occasional adventurous sniff through the Georgia pines. But with that wonderful rural lifestyle comes red clay stains, burrs in their fur, and pollen that seems to coat everything, including our four-legged friends. That’s where the modern concept of a dog spa comes in. It’s so much more than a simple wash. For Yatesville pet owners, it’s a cornerstone of proactive, loving care tailored to our unique environment.

Think of a dog spa as a wellness retreat designed specifically for your pup. Yes, they’ll get a superb, deep-clean bath that tackles that infamous red dirt. But they’ll also benefit from services that directly address local needs. A professional deshedding treatment during our seasonal changes can keep your home cooler and your dog more comfortable. A gentle, moisturizing paw pad treatment can soothe pads dried out or irritated by our hot pavements and rough terrain. For dogs who love to explore, a spa visit can include a thorough check and cleaning of ears and eyes, helping to prevent infections from dust and allergens.

One of the greatest benefits for our community is the professional handling of grooming tasks that can be stressful to do at home. Many of us have tried to wrestle with nail trims or express anal glands, often with less-than-ideal results. A skilled groomer at a quality dog spa performs these essential services safely and calmly, turning a potential ordeal into a peaceful experience. This is especially valuable for larger breeds or senior dogs common in our area, who may need extra care and expertise.

So, how do you choose the right spa for your Yatesville pup? Start by asking local neighbors for recommendations—word-of-mouth is gold in a close-knit town. Visit the facility. It should be clean, well-organized, and the staff should be happy to answer your questions about their products and processes. Look for groomers who emphasize a fear-free, compassionate approach. A good spa will always prioritize your dog’s comfort over everything else, offering breaks and using positive reinforcement.

Integrating a dog spa visit into your pet care routine isn’t a luxury; it’s a smart part of responsible ownership. Schedule a spa day every 4-8 weeks, aligning it with seasonal shifts. It’s an investment that pays off in a cleaner home, a healthier, more comfortable dog, and the peace of mind knowing you’re addressing the specific challenges our beautiful Yatesville landscape presents. Your pup will not only look great but feel fantastic, ready for their next adventure down our scenic backroads.
